Yao Ming will not see more then 24 minutes on the court this season and the Rockets are hoping that will keep him healthy for the playoffs. If Yao Ming is healthy for the playoffs the Rockets will become instant contenders. The Rockets are a versatile offense team because they can be a fast break team or play half court. When Yao Ming is on the court they can feed him the basketball and take open 3 pointers and when he is off the court Aaron Brooks and Kevin Martin can run and gun. Luis Scola and Shane Battier are the two glue players who can take over a game without scoring. Battier has always been one of the best role players in the NBA playing top notch defense and nailing 3 pointers. With Yao Ming in the lineup Scola will only be asked to rebound and defend, but if Ming gets hurt Scola will definite be a force on offense. The Rockets also have a couple of solid bench players in Brand Miller, Kyle Lowry, Courtney Lee, and promising rookie Patrick Patterson.

The Rockets have a built a solid team that should definitely make the playoffs and if Yao Ming is healthy contend for a championship. Aaron Brooks and Kevin Martin will look to take some of the scoring burden off Yao Ming and that should help them keep his minutes reduced. Scola will do all the dirty work and play major minutes because he can take over on offense when Ming is sitting. The Rockets are still looking for players to fill the roster and were hoping to trade for Carmelo Anthony. If the Rockets are not contending or fighting for a playoff spot look for the them to make a trade around the deadline.
